This policy covers children and other dependants up to and including the age of 20, students up to and including the age of 30, as well as persons with a disability who qualify as a child or other dependant or student in these age ranges.

Simple Options is our great-value Extras cover that offers a percentage back on the services included. It's ideal for singles, couples and families looking for a value packed cover that offers major and general dental, optical, podiatry consultations, pharmacy, chiro, physio, osteo, healthy lifestyle and ambulance services.
In Northern Territory this policy provides:
Emergency: Unlimited with a waiting period of 1 day.
Non-emergency: Unlimited transport with a waiting period of 30 days.
Call-out fees: will be paid for each attendance, including emergency treatment without transport to hospital.
There is no limit to the number of emergency ambulance services you use. If you’re taken to a hospital’s emergency department for urgent treatment, we’ll cover 100% of the charge. If it’s a non-emergency ambulance service, you only make a $50 co-payment per trip. Not covered: Inter-hospital transportation except for inter-hospital transfers relating to an emergency or new illness where approved on a case by case basis by HIF. Transportation from a hospital to your home, nursing home or other hospital. Transportation for ongoing medical treatment. Off road, sea or air ambulance (plane, helicopter or boat).
